Where should mobile be placed in crib?

Newborns have and optimum visual range of 8 to 12 inches (20 to 30cm) and have trouble focusing on things further away than that. Start by hanging your mobile about 16 inches (40cm) above the surface of the crib mattress. If baby doesn’t seem to be responding or interacting then lower it a little until they do.2020-02-24

What is the most common injury due to cribs?

The most common mechanism of injury was a fall from a crib, playpen, or bassinet, representing 66.2% of injuries. Soft-tissue injuries comprised the most common diagnosis (34.1%), and the most frequently injured body region was the head or neck (40.3%).

How long can you keep a mobile in a crib?

When your baby starts pushing up onto her hands and knees, (usually at around 4 to 5 months of age), it’s time to get rid of the mobile — she could reach it, and that’s dangerous. “Infants have been strangled by the strings attached to crib mobiles,” says Mark A.

Can you hang a baby mobile from the ceiling?

Select a 1⁄4 in (0.64 cm) screw hook to install on the ceiling. Screw hooks, or cup hooks, come in a variety of sizes. A screw hook has a threaded end that fits in the ceiling like a screw and a hook end you can use to hold the mobile. Small ones are more than capable of handling most mobiles.

Can baby get injured in crib?

More than 80% of the injuries involved cribs, and two-thirds of reported injuries occurred when children fell from the crib or jumped out. About 15% of injuries resulted from falling inside the crib or hitting or being cut on the inside of the crib. About 6% resulted from becoming caught or wedged in the crib.2011-02-16

What is safe to hang over crib?

“It’s best for parents to avoid putting anything above, or within arm’s reach of the crib, and that includes any furniture or wall hangings,” says Keys. Instead, parents could opt for a safer alternative such as wallpaper, an accent wall, or something painted right onto the wall, like a mural.2021-06-09
